The first step for any beginner planning to invest on foreclosed properties is to understand the foreclosure process. Foreclosure happens when homeowners fail to make their monthly payments. Their lenders take the properties and resell them in order to get the money that has not been paid by homeowners.
Aside from defaulting on mortgage payments, there are other possible reasons for foreclosure. Some of them are:
?Failure to pay property taxes
?Lack of necessary insurance
?Balloon payment on adjustable rate mortgage
?Failure to maintain the good condition of a property
The foreclosure process has three major stages:
1.Pre-foreclosure is the first stage in a foreclosure process. It is the period in between the homeowner defaulting on payments and the bank putting up the property on sale. Pre-foreclosure is one of the best opportunities for investors to work on their transactions as they can negotiate directly with the homeowner.
2.Auction is the second stage in a foreclosure process. The property is taken possession of and put on sale during this stage. This is the time for home investors to top the bid as the best properties are granted to the highest bidders.
3.The final stage in foreclosure is when real estate becomes owned by the bank, also known as REO. This happens when the property does not sell during the auction or when the lender turns out to win the bidding. Banks usually sell REO homes on the open market.
There are times when government agencies like the Department of Housing and Urban Development conduct the auction. Most of the time, government auctions take place on the Internet. Buyers are allowed to check the properties in advance. One disadvantage of a government auction is that there is only a limited number of properties. This means that many bidders compete over the same foreclosed properties resulting to only little discount on market price.
